Received this update from James:
“Played Highland Creek yesterday, and echo everything B-man stated a few weeks back. On the positive side, the course was in immaculate shape, and the wasp problem had been solved. The greens ran very smooth (much more so than Birkdale), and the traps were well-maintained.
HOWEVER, the pin placements were ridiculous. There was one hole in particular, #6 I believe, where three of the four in our group hit the green with short chips and rolled back off the green. Not only does that reduce the fun factor, but it slows down play. We’re not out there to play a tournament… Additionally, the GPS was to the center of the green. Why even have it?”
